Readability and Cutting Machine Compatibility
One of the key considerations when using a script font like Saga is ensuring it remains readable, especially when used in small sizes or cut by machines like Cricut or Silhouette. Saga’s design is optimized for clarity, making it suitable for stickers, labels, and other small-format designs. Its open letterforms and smooth curves help prevent distortion during cutting, resulting in clean, professional-looking outcomes.
When creating mockups or previews, be sure to test Saga at different sizes and resolutions to ensure it maintains its beauty without losing legibility. This is especially important for printed cards, product packaging, and social media graphics where the font needs to stand out without being overwhelming.
Font Pairing Ideas for Creative Projects
Saga pairs beautifully with a variety of other fonts, allowing you to create dynamic and visually interesting designs. For a balanced look, try pairing it with a clean sans serif font like Montserrat or Lato. This contrast highlights Saga’s personality while keeping the overall design modern and easy to read.
If you're working with a bold display font, consider pairing it with a simple serif font like Playfair Display or Georgia. This combination adds depth and hierarchy to your design, making it ideal for logos, packaging, and web design. Saga’s softness complements stronger typefaces, creating a harmonious visual balance.
For digital printables and SVG-style designs, Saga can serve as the main text element, while other fonts handle supporting details. This approach keeps your designs organized and professional, ensuring that every element contributes to the overall aesthetic.
